EDITORS COMMENTS
This photograph transports us back in time to the magical world of Maskelyne's Theatre in Langham Place, London during the 1930s. The focus of the image is on the enigmatic figure of the spotlight operator, whose unseen hand controls the intricate machinery that brings the stage to life. With a knowing smile and intense concentration, he manipulates the levers and dials of the lighting equipment, casting beams of light on the performers below. The theatre, a hub of mystery and wonder, was renowned for its magic shows and illusions, making the role of the spotlight operator all the more crucial in creating an immersive and mesmerizing experience for the audience. The warm glow of the spotlight illuminates the stage, while the shadows cast by the surrounding equipment add an element of intrigue and drama. The hustle and bustle of the technical side of the theatre is a world away from the glamour and glitz of the performances, yet it is this behind-the-scenes work that brings the magic to life. This photograph is a testament to the unsung heroes of the theatre world, the technicians and operators who work tirelessly to ensure that every performance is a success.
